char和int的區別
char和int的區別
1、存儲空間不同:char占用一個字節的內存空間,而int占用四個字節的內存空間,這取決于不同的編譯器和操作系統,但通常情況下是這樣。2、內存地址不同:char和int類型的變量在內存中占用不同的地址空間,此外,char類型變量的內存地址變化規律與int類型變量的內存地址變化規律不同,有一個char類型的指針變量,自增1后,指向的地址將是下一個字節的地址;而有一個int類型的指針變量,自增1后,指向的地址將是下一個int類型的地址,int類型占用多個字節。3、存儲不僅僅是數據臨時或長期駐留在物理媒介上的過程,更重要的是包含了如何保證數據安全和完整的一系列方法和行為,這些方法旨在為客戶提供一套可靠的數據存放解決方案。
導讀1、存儲空間不同:char占用一個字節的內存空間,而int占用四個字節的內存空間,這取決于不同的編譯器和操作系統,但通常情況下是這樣。2、內存地址不同:char和int類型的變量在內存中占用不同的地址空間,此外,char類型變量的內存地址變化規律與int類型變量的內存地址變化規律不同,有一個char類型的指針變量,自增1后,指向的地址將是下一個字節的地址;而有一個int類型的指針變量,自增1后,指向的地址將是下一個int類型的地址,int類型占用多個字節。3、存儲不僅僅是數據臨時或長期駐留在物理媒介上的過程,更重要的是包含了如何保證數據安全和完整的一系列方法和行為,這些方法旨在為客戶提供一套可靠的數據存放解決方案。
![](https://img.51dongshi.com/20241201/wz/18268733652.jpg)
區別是存儲空間不同,內存地址不同。1、存儲空間不同:char占用一個字節的內存空間,而int占用四個字節的內存空間,這取決于不同的編譯器和操作系統,但通常情況下是這樣。2、內存地址不同:char和int類型的變量在內存中占用不同的地址空間,此外,char類型變量的內存地址變化規律與int類型變量的內存地址變化規律不同,有一個char類型的指針變量,自增1后,指向的地址將是下一個字節的地址;而有一個int類型的指針變量,自增1后,指向的地址將是下一個int類型的地址,int類型占用多個字節。3、存儲不僅僅是數據臨時或長期駐留在物理媒介上的過程,更重要的是包含了如何保證數據安全和完整的一系列方法和行為,這些方法旨在為客戶提供一套可靠的數據存放解決方案。
char和int的區別
1、存儲空間不同:char占用一個字節的內存空間,而int占用四個字節的內存空間,這取決于不同的編譯器和操作系統,但通常情況下是這樣。2、內存地址不同:char和int類型的變量在內存中占用不同的地址空間,此外,char類型變量的內存地址變化規律與int類型變量的內存地址變化規律不同,有一個char類型的指針變量,自增1后,指向的地址將是下一個字節的地址;而有一個int類型的指針變量,自增1后,指向的地址將是下一個int類型的地址,int類型占用多個字節。3、存儲不僅僅是數據臨時或長期駐留在物理媒介上的過程,更重要的是包含了如何保證數據安全和完整的一系列方法和行為,這些方法旨在為客戶提供一套可靠的數據存放解決方案。
為你推薦